This is really not for one-person backpacking. It is too heavy for one person with other gear to carry. However, if it is shared between 2, 3, or 4 people who can distribute the entire weight of their gear evenly, then yes, it is great for backpacking. One person carries this set, another carries the hatchet, a third person carries the small backpacking stove, etc. The two cooking pots are thicker stainless steel and better quality than I expected. The pan/lid is thinner but still good quality. Stainless steel is always easy to clean and does not leach metal toxins like aluminum. The PVC pot handles are convenient if only used with a gas-fueled stove, not campfires. They would quickly burn and melt away over a campfire (it happened to me with a smaller set years ago). The stainless cutlery is cute but almost unnecessary and adds weight. The silicone rubber bowl/cups are worthless. The larger bowl was already torn along a fold when I opened the set. The silicone cups are too thin. They do not remain closed when folded and are too thin to remain safely upright when holding hot liquid/coffee/soup/tea. They clumsily flop around and spill their contents. I threw them away and use a thicker set of folding silicone cups that I had on hand. ... show more

Bad materials and design. The bowls developed rust spots just from drying after hand washing. The utensils taste like metal near the part that folds. And the bag materials are really cheap and flimsy. Not good quality, wouldn't expect more than a few uses. The pan handle also has a design defect where, during use, it's possible to have the pan handle detatch—this actually ejected half of a meal we were cooking at camp. This looks like other high quality sets, but in my experience those more expensive options don't have these flaws. ... show more
